Real wage growth in #Ukraine accelerated to 14.1% y/y in May / bne IntelliNews
By bne IntelliNews July 2, 2018

Real wages in Ukraine grew 14.1% y/y in May, accelerating from 12.5% y/y growth in April, the State Statistics Service reported on June 27.

The average monthly nominal wage increased to UAH8,725 a month ($333) from UAH8,480 in May, which is 2.9% m/m growth in real terms.

The leading regions for average monthly wages remained the city of Kyiv (UAH13,286), the Ukrainian-controlled Donetsk region (UAH10,166) and the Kyiv region (UAH8,783).

The largest nominal average wage growth was in public services (48% y/y), science and technology services (38% y/y), and transportation (31%). Within the industrial sector, the highest nominal wages remained in pharmaceuticals (UAH15,426), mining (UAH12,335), and metallurgy (UAH10,78.).

“Cooling inflation has helped to maintain a high growth rate of wages in real terms. We expect real wages to increase 9-10% in 2018,” Evgeniya Akhtyrko of Concorde Capital said in a note.
